    ### Eingabe- und Ausgabemodell in der Dokumentation { #model-for-input-and-output-in-docs }
    
    Und wenn Sie alle verfügbaren Schemas (JSON-Schemas) in OpenAPI überprüfen, werden Sie feststellen, dass es zwei gibt, ein `Item-Input` und ein `Item-Output`.
    
    Für `Item-Input` ist `description` **nicht erforderlich**, es hat kein rotes Sternchen.
    
    Aber für `Item-Output` ist `description` **erforderlich**, es hat ein rotes Sternchen.
